January 12, 2026 On this the 12th day of January 2026 at 6:30 pm the City Council of the City of Friona, Texas, convened in regular session at the regular meeting place thereof, in the Friona City Council Chambers, 619 Main Street, the meeting being open to the public and notice of said meeting having been given as prescribed by Chapter 551 of the Government Code, with the members being present and in attendance, to wit: Greg Lewellen, Mayor Alan Monroe, Mayor Pro-Tem Andy Alexander, Council Member Brent Loflin, Council Member David Gonzales, Council Member (arrived at 6:58 p.m.) Leander Davila, City Manager/City Secretary Not Present: Esmeralda Mills, Council Member Others present included: Becky Upton, Friona Public Library Anahi Gomez, Friona Public Library Clint Mears, Friona Star Wendy Carthel, Friona Economic Development Corporation Mia Reyna, Water Utility Clerk Marie Samarron, Friona Municipal Court Judge Slater Elza, City Attorney Mayor Lewellen called the meeting to order at 6:33 p.m. ITEM 1 ROLL CALL Mayor Lewellen called roll and announced that a quorum was present. ITEM 2 INVOCATION AND PLEDGE OF ALLEGIANCE. Mayor Pro-Tem Monroe gave the Invocation and Council Member Loflin led the Pledge of Allegiance. ITEM 3 HEAR PUBLIC COMMENTS There were no public comments REGULAR HEARING: The regular hearing was opened at 6:38 p.m. ITEM 4 CONSIDER AND TAKE ACTION ON APPROVAL OF MINUTES OF THE DECEMBER 8, 2025, REGULAR CITY COUNCIL MEETING MOTION Mayor Pro-Tem Monroe made the motion to approve the minutes of the December 8, 2025 Regular City Council Meeting. The second to the motion was made by Council Member Loflin and the motion passed with a 3/0 vote. Note: Item 5 was moved to be heard after Item 11. ITEM 6 CONSIDER AND TAKE ACTION ON APPROVAL OF ACCOUNTS PAYABLE FOR DECEMBER 2025 City Manager/City Secretary Davila reviewed Accounts Payable MOTION Council Member Loflin made the motion to Accounts Payable for December 2025. The second to the motion was made by Council Member Alexander and the motion passed with a 3/0 vote ITEM 7 CONSIDER AND TAKE ACTION ON APPROVAL OF THE FINANCIAL STATEMENT FOR DECEMBER 2025 City Manager/City Secretary Davila reviewed the Financial Statement MOTION Mayor Pro-Tem Monroe made the motion to approve the Financial Statement for December 2026. The second to the motion was made by Council Member Loflin and the motion passed with a 3/0 vote ITEM 8 CONSIDER AND TAKE ACTION ON APPROVAL OF FIRST QUARTERLY FINANCIAL STATEMENT OCTOBER 2025 THROUGH DECEMBER 2025 MOTION Mayor Pro-Tem Monroe made the motion to approve on the first quarterly financial statement October 2025 through December 2025. The second to the motion was made by Council Member Alexander and the motion was passed with a 3/0 vote. ITEM 9 DISCUSSION REGARDING THE UPCOMING 2026 CITY OF FRIONA ELECTIONS AND CRITICAL DEADLINES City Manager/City Secretary Davila reviewed the 2026 City of Friona Election Calendar and reviewed the documentation supporting the Student Poll Worker Program. Those positions up for election include the Mayor (Lewellen) and two Council Member positions (Gonzales and Loflin). ITEM 10 DISCUSSION AND BRIEFING ON THE UPCOMING FRIONA CITY MANAGER RECRUITMENT PROCESS City Manager/City Secretary Davila provided an update on the City Manager recruitment. ITEM 11 CONSIDER AND TAKE ACTION TO APPROVE ORDINANCE NO. 2026.01.12 AMENDING THE CITY CODE TO REMOVE THE CITY SECRETARY POSITION AND DUTIES FROM THE CITY MANAGER; ESTABLISHING THE CITY SECRETARY AS A SEPARATE POSITION FROM THE CITY MANAGER; PROVIDING THAT THE CITY SECRETARY SHALL REPORT TO THE CITY MANAGER; PROVIDING FOR SEVERABILITY; AND PROVIDING AN EFFECTIVE DATE MOTION Council Member Alexander made the motion to approve Ordinance No. 2026.01.12 amending the City code to remove the City Secretary position and duties from the City Manager; establishing the City Secretary as a separate position from the City Manager; providing that the City Secretary shall report to the City Manager; providing for severability; and providing an effective date. The second to the motion was made by Council Member Loflin and the motion was passed with a 3/0 vote. ITEM 5 HEAR DEPARTMENTAL REPORT FROM THE FRIONA MUNICIPAL COURT REGARDING BUDGET, EXPENSES, PERSONNEL, AND UPCOMING EVENTS MOTION Judge Samarron provided the City Council with a departmental report from the Friona Municipal Court, which included updates on the court’s budget, expenses, personnel, and upcoming events. Judge Samarron requested to go into executive session as well to speak to the City Council about personnel matters and consultation with the City Attorney. EXECUTIVE SESSION: Mayor Lewellen went into Executive Session at 7:01 p.m. ITEM 12 CITY COUNCIL WILL CONVENE INTO EXECUTIVE SESSION PURSUANT TO SECTION 551.074, TEXAS GOVERNMENT CODE (PERSONNEL MATTERS), TO DELIBERATE THE DUTIES, RESPONSIBILITIES, AND CONTINUED ELIGIBILITY OF AN ELECTED OFFICIAL RELATED TO THE MAYOR’S OFFICE Mayor Lewellen went out of Executive Session at 7:52 p.m. REGULAR HEARINGS: ITEM 13 RECONVENE INTO REGULAR SESSION AND CONSIDER ACTION IF ANY, ON ITEM 12 DISCUSSED IN EXECUTIVE SESSION No action taken on Item 12 or Judge Samarron’s discussion in Executive Session. ITEM 14 ADJOURNMENT With no further business at hand the meeting was adjourned at 7:53 p.m. APPROVED: Greg Lewellen, Mayor ATTEST: Leander Davila, City Secretary
